IndisputableMonolith.Foundation.RS_FDN_Structural_008
Foundation module that packages a domain cost functional, its nonnegativity and reference-point identity, and a strictly positive canonical threshold into the structural certificate RS-FDN-008. Auditors of the Recognition forcing chain cite it when a certified nonnegative cost-on-domain with fixed cutoff is required. Content is definitional plus elementary positivity and inhabitation lemmas over Cost and Constants.
claimIntroduces a domain cost $C$ with $C \ge 0$, an identity $C$ at a reference evaluation, and a canonical threshold $\theta > 0$, assembled as the inhabited structural certificate RS-FDN-Structural-008.
background
Recognition Science measures mismatch by a nonnegative cost built from the unique $J$-functional forced in the T5 step of the unified forcing chain. The Cost import supplies that cost infrastructure; Constants supplies the RS-native time quantum $\tau_0 = 1$ tick used as the discrete unit of recognition.
This module sits in the Foundation structural layer. It specializes the ambient cost to a domain cost (a real-valued functional on the working domain), records that the cost is nonnegative, and fixes a canonical positive threshold against which domain values may be compared. The threshold is the structural cutoff used by later certificate consumers, not a derived physical constant such as the Berry threshold $\phi^{-1}$.
Sibling declarations name the pieces: the domain cost itself, its evaluation identity, nonnegativity, the canonical threshold and its positivity, and the certificate record together with an inhabitation proof.
proof idea
Definition-and-certificate module rather than a deep theorem development. Domain cost and canonical threshold are introduced as definitions; nonnegativity and positivity are discharged by elementary real inequalities inherited from the Cost layer. The certificate record bundles those facts; inhabitation is a one-line constructor application showing the bundle is realized.
why it matters in Recognition Science
Closes structural item RS-FDN-008 in the Foundation layer: a reusable, Lean-certified package of nonnegative domain cost plus positive cutoff. Downstream used-by edges are empty in the current graph, so the module presently acts as a leaf certificate that later forcing or measurement developments can import without re-proving cost positivity. It does not itself advance T5–T8 (J-uniqueness, $\phi$, eight-tick octave, $D=3$), but supplies the cost-side scaffolding those steps assume when they quantify recognition mismatch on a domain.
